And for today’s tip here’s some nice info on being fit

Being fit means you are overall healthier. You cut down your odds of suffering from a variety of serious conditions, such as heart disease, respiratory disease and even cancer.

Being fit means you have more energy for the things you want to do in your life. That means more energy for having fun with family and friends. It’s having the energy after work to do something more than crash on the couch.

Being fit tends to give confidence. You look good and you probably know it. Other people are likely to notice too. Confident people tend to draw attention even when they aren’t trying to.
Being fit can help you to age more gracefully. It makes it easier to maintain agility, flexibility and strength.

Some days you can feel like it isn’t worth all the trouble to maintain a fitness regimen. It’s hard work and it can be frustrating when you aren’t seeing the results you dreamed of. It can just mean you need to give yourself more time to achieve that goal.
